The Robotic Bochum Twin Telescope (RoBoTT) operated from December 2008 to September 2019 at the Universitaetssternwarte Bochum near Cerro Armazones in the Chilean Atacama desert. It consists of two refractor telescopes (15 cm aperture, 2°42'' × 2°42'' FoV CCDs) attached to the same mount. The fields were observed in Johnson UVBRI, Sloan ugriz, and the narrowband OIII, NB, Halpha, and SII filters. The first batch contains fields that were observed in Johnson U and Sloan z; further RoBoTT fields will be added at a later date. Bochum Galactic Disk Survey (BGDS) images, which were also taken with the RoBoTT, are available separately from ivo://org.gavo.dc/bgds/q/sia.

Note calib

The calib_level flag takes the following values:

0 Raw Instrumental data requiring instrument-specific tools
1 Instrumental data processable with standard tools
2 Calibrated, science-ready data without instrument signature
3 Enhanced data products (e.g., mosaics)
